Tamil actor Selvakumar passes away
Tamil film industry witnessed a tragic incident as the character artist R Selvakumar passed away in a road accident at T Nagar in Chennai on Thursday night.
The actor was 59. He is survived by his wife K Geetha and two daughters.
Selvakumar, who was also a TV serial actor met the accident, while he was coming back to his house along with his friend, Kovai Senthil, who was riding pillion on the two-wheeler.
It is said that wire of his two-wheeler got entangled in the front wheel, which made the bike to lose its balance and the bike fell on the road.
Due to this, the actor suffered head injury and reportedly died on the spot.
He was not wearing a helmet at that time.
The pillion rider sustained little injury and he was shifted to a hospital.
The actor, a resident of T Nagar, apart from enacting roles in TV serials, he acted in more than 300 films.
